#50118d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#50118d is composed of 31.4% red, 6.7% green and 55.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 43.3% cyan, 87.9% magenta, 0% yellow and 44.7% black. It has a hue angle of 270.5 degrees, a saturation of 78.5% and a lightness of 31%. #50118d color hex could be obtained by blending #a022ff with #00001b. Closest websafe color is: #660099.

#50118d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#50118d has RGB values of R:80, G:17, B:141 and CMYK values of C:0.43, M:0.88, Y:0, K:0.45. Its decimal value is 5247373.

Shades and Tints of #50118d
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010001 is the darkest color, while #f6eefd is the lightest one.

Tones of #50118d
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#4f4e50 is the less saturated color, while #500599 is the most saturated one.
